Variant summary

Our verdict is Pathogenic. Variant got 20 ACMG points: 20P and 0B. PVS1PM2PP3_ModeratePP5_Very_Strong

The NM_000030.3(AGXT):​c.777-1G>C variant causes a splice acceptor change.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.0000291 in 1,614,076 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. In-silico tool predicts a pathogenic outcome for this variant. 3/3 splice prediction tools predicting alterations to normal splicing.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Likely pathogenic (★★).

Genes affected
AGXT (HGNC:341): (alanine--glyoxylate aminotransferase) This gene is expressed only in the liver and the encoded protein is localized mostly in the peroxisomes, where it is involved in glyoxylate detoxification. Mutations in this gene, some of which alter subcellular targetting, have been associated with type I primary hyperoxaluria.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2008]

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ingWomen's Health and Genetics/Laboratory Corporation of America, LabCorpJun 03, 2019Variant summary: AGXT c.777-1G>C is located in a canonical splice-site and is predicted to affect mRNA splicing resulting in a significantly altered protein due to either exon skipping, shortening, or inclusion of intronic material. Several computational tools predict a significant impact on normal splicing: Five predict the variant abolishes a 3 acceptor site. However, these predictions have yet to be confirmed by functional studies.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 1.6e-05 in 251268 control chromosomes (gnomAD). The variant, c.777-1G>C, has been reported in the literature in multiple individuals affected with Primary Hyperoxaluria Type 1 (Coulter-Mackie_2004, Coulter-Mackie_2005, Monico_2007, Williams_2015). These data indicate that the variant is very likely to be associated with disease. At least one publication, Coulter-Mackie_2004, reports AGT activity of this variant from a patients liver biopsy was <10% of normal activity. One ClinVar submission from other clinical diagnostic laboratories (evaluation after 2014) cites the variant as pathogenic. Based on the evidence outlined above, the variant was classified as pathogenic. -

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ingInvitaeAug 25, 2023For these reasons, this variant has been classified as Pathogenic. Algorithms developed to predict the effect of sequence changes on RNA splicing suggest that this variant may disrupt the consensus splice site. 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 188774). Disruption of this splice site has been observed in individual(s) with primary hyperoxaluria type 1 (PMID: 15110324, 15963748, 17460142, 25629080). This variant is present in population databases (rs180177267, gnomAD 0.004%). This sequence change affects an acceptor splice site in intron 7 of the AGXT gene. It is expected to disrupt RNA splicing. Variants that disrupt the donor or acceptor splice site typically lead to a loss of protein function (PMID: 16199547), and loss-of-function variants in AGXT are known to be pathogenic (PMID: 19479957). -
